Overview

Triggering receptor expressed on myeloid cells like 3, pseudogene (TREML3P), also known as TREM like transcript 3 (TLT3), is a human pseudogene located in a gene cluster on chromosome 6 with structurally related genes such as TREM1 and TREM2. In mice, TREM-3 is a functional receptor involved in the immune response, but in humans, TREML3P lacks known protein-coding ability—that is, it does not encode a functional protein product and has no known biological or therapeutic role. Therefore, it is not considered a therapeutic target in humans[4][1].\n\nClarifications:\n- TREML3P is frequently confused with related functional receptors (like TREM-1, TREM-2, or murine TREM-3) that have established biological and therapeutic significance, but TREML3P itself is nonfunctional in humans and should not be considered a drug target or biomarker[4][1][3].
